Output dd3b21097e782e9b83881d332c7776df3269c4fd80b35b5b8e948e29c82a13bf:0

value
123025
script pubkey
OP_0 OP_PUSHBYTES_20 d8e90bf20f86319d98ce7fe31342ab2bd27dd5f9
address
bc1qmr5shus0sccemxxw0l33xs4t90f8m40e8jn75g
transaction
dd3b21097e782e9b83881d332c7776df3269c4fd80b35b5b8e948e29c82a13bf
confirmations
166889
spent
true